Corn Chowder Canadian Style might be a good recipe to expand your main course recipe box. This recipe serves 6. One portion of this dish contains roughly 20g of protein, 41g of fat, and a total of 598 calories. If you have milk, corn, butter, and a few other ingredients on hand, you can make it. To use up the milk you could follow this main course with the Milky Way Brownie Bites as a dessert. From preparation to the plate, this recipe takes roughly 45 minutes.
